BOSS OVERLY AMBITIOUS, GOES OUT OF HER WAY TO IMPRESS BUT MAKES STAFF DO ALL THE WORK

How to deal with an overly ambitious boss?

Advertisements

Current boss is normally nice and patient but when it involves projects with cross functional teams, aka peers of her level, she tends to include a whole spreadsheet of bullet points to include.

Her points are often great and “goes out of the way to impress”, and I always try to support her and do up a nice presentation.

However, she is like an advisor, doing all the talk while I go crazy, amidst all the other projects i have, to make last minute changes to her points.

Sometimes she contradicts her point and I would have to scramble to make changes again. Makes me feel that all this talk is easy, but I’m dying to do all the work.

Normal? How should I manage my boss?

Netizens’ comments

  • If it’s pushing you beyond capacity then I’d explain just that: “Sorry, I don’t have the bandwidth to do this right now. If you really need it done, perhaps we can discuss another task I can push back to create time to work on this.”
    I guess whether or not this is realistic depends on what kind of person your boss is and whether they will hold you personally accountable for not doing that, but the only way your boss can adjust her behaviour is for her to know that she is pushing you beyond what is reasonable.
    Then you guys can hopefully have a mature conversation about how to approach this problem and take it from there.
  • This is not an “overly ambitious” boss.
    This is a boss who creates busywork for subordinates to do in order to look good in front of her peers while (I am guessing) not giving subordinates enough credit.
    During your next review with her try to ask some questions about your growth potential in the company. E.g. what do you have to do in order to get a promotion. Assuming she gives a proper and doable plan of action, write an email summarising that. Future ammo for you to present to HR should she not promote you.
